Bachelor of Science in Criminology
A four-year degree program that studies crime and the various agencies of justice roles as they operate and react to crime, criminals, and victims.
is a four-year course that is geared towards careers in police administration, corrections, scientific crime detection, jail management and penology, fire protection and industrial security.
